Ingredients
Scale
For the Crust:
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 2 large eggs
- 1 can (20 oz) crushed pineapple, undrained
- 1/2 cup chopped pecans
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 3 cups powdered sugar
- 1/2 cup chopped pecans (for topping)
Instructions
1. Prepare the Crust:
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9×13-inch baking pan.
- In a large bowl, mix fl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t. Add eggs, crushed pineapple, pecans, and vanilla. Stir until well combined.
- Pour batter into the prepared pan and b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Let cool completely.
- For the frosting, beat butter and cream cheese until smooth. Gradually add powdered sugar and mix until creamy.
- Spread frosting over the cooled cake and sprinkle with chopped pecans. Refrigerate for at least 1 hour before serving.
